About the role
We are seeking an Executive Manager – Squad Cyber Technical Lead to lead the delivery of a cybersecurity squad across four key workstreams: Application Security (AppSec), AI Governance, Continuous Security Validation, and Compliance & Evidence Management.
The role will ensure delivery is aligned with 2nd Line of Defense (2LoD) approved policies, defined SLAs, regulatory requirements, and CBUAE inspection-readiness. The successful candidate will provide technical leadership across DevSecOps, cloud security, and AI/LLM security within a highly regulated banking environment.
Key Responsibilities
Lead and oversee delivery across AppSec, AI Governance, Continuous Security Validation, and Compliance Trail workstreams.
Ensure adherence to approved security policies, controls, SLAs, and regulatory requirements.
Own and manage the consolidated cybersecurity tooling ecosystem, including tools such as SonarQube, Snyk, ServiceNow IRM, Security Agent, Claude, Codex, OPA, Microsoft Defender for Cloud, and AWS Security Hub.
Drive vendor consolidation, tooling integration, and security architecture across the technology landscape.
Establish and maintain an end-to-end security evidence and attestation framework, including the DefectDojo Attestation Power BI reporting chain.
Act as the 1st Line of Defense (1LoD) technical counterpart to 2LoD Risk/Compliance and the AI Centre of Excellence.
Chair the Security Champions Guild and drive collaboration, knowledge sharing, and security adoption across engineering teams.
Resolve cross-workstream priorities, dependencies, risks, and technical challenges.
Prepare and present the monthly DevSecOps Governance Dashboard to 2LoD stakeholders.
Ensure continuous regulatory and audit readiness, with a strong focus on CBUAE requirements and inspection preparedness.
Drive implementation of security controls across cloud, application, AI/ML, and DevSecOps environments.
